You should have all your information available before you apply for a mortgage. Most lenders require a standard set of documents pertaining to income and employment. They want to see W2s, bank statements, pay stubs as well as income tax returns. When these documents are readily available it makes the process smoother and faster.

Balloon mortgages are among the easier to obtain. This is a short-term loan option, and you have to get the amount owed refinanced when the loan has expired. This is risky due to possible increases in rates can change or your financial situation can get worse.

After you have your mortgage, work on paying extra money to principal every month. This practice allows you to pay down your loan more quickly. Paying as little as an additional hundred dollars more per month on your loan can actually reduce how long you need to pay off the loan by 10 years.
